带有GoDaddy自定义域的Windows Azure虚拟机

时间:2013-11-18 04:20:05

标签: dns cname azure-virtual-machine

我在使用Azure虚拟机(我计划在其上运行多个网站)上设置自定义域(在GoDaddy.com上购买)时遇到问题。我已经设置了一些Endpoints(80用于Http和443 for SSL)我正在使用CNAME的{​​{1}},我将VM IIS中的绑定设置为我的Azure VM myvm.cloudapp.net。瞧,一切正常。问题是Azure会偶尔改变这个IP ...所以我的问题是,有没有更好的方法来设置它,以便我不必担心IP地址的变化?

1 个答案:

答案 0 :(得分:1)

您正在寻找的搜索关键字是“动态DNS”。

在某处设置动态DNS帐户(例如http://www.noip.com/free/或DynDns,还有许多其他帐号)。您将从他们那里获得一个主机名,以及您运行的一些客户端软件可以更新其DNS服务器(某些路由器还在其硬件中内置了动态DNS客户端)。然后为您的真实域/子域添加指向动态DNS主机名的CNAME条目。有关概述,请参阅http://en.wikipedia.org/wiki/Dynamic_DNS

您的DNS提供商也可能拥有自己的动态DNS客户端软件,只能使用他们的服务 - 询问他们是否支持动态DNS(或在其支持网站上搜索)。就个人而言,我跳过中间人,只使用ZoneEdit的名称服务器(http://www.zoneedit.com/dynamicDNS.html,而不是免费)用于所有DNS服务。他们拥有动态DNS支持。